Beat The Summer Heat In UAE With These 7 Refreshing Plants

The climate of the UAE is very hot and humid. In summer, the average temperature reaches above 50 degrees Celsius. The rise in temperature makes the atmosphere quite suffocating and people have no other option than to remain shut in the air-conditioned buildings.

You may not control the rising temperature outside but you can try ways to keep the indoors cool. Plants are natural ways to enhance air quality and keep our homes cooler. They lose water during transpiration that cools the air around and leaves it fresh and purified. You can keep plants in your bedroom, hang in the balcony or decorate at the entrance of the home to keep the atmosphere cool and calm.

Here is a list of some of the best indoor and outdoor plants that will help you beat the summer heat in UAE.

Money Plant

One of the most common household plants, the Money plant is a tropical vining plant native to Europe, North Africa, and West Asia. It is an air-purifying plant that energizes the home by filtering air and increasing the inflow of oxygen. It can be potted in a small pot or even a glass bottle. If you are growing the money plant outside, make sure to plant it under a covered area.

Areca Palm

The Areca Palm, also known as golden cane palm and butterfly palm is the most popularly grown indoor plants. Every year these plants can grow about 6 to 10 inches until they reach the height of 6 or 7 feet. With enough light and warm temperature, the Areca palm will thrive well wherever you keep it.

Peace Lily

The Peace Lily is an evergreen herbaceous perennial plant, native to tropical regions of the Americas & southeastern Asia. It makes an excellent houseplant for the home or office that can grow up to 16 inches tall indoor and up to 6 feet tall outdoors. Excellent at cleaning the air, Peace Lily can also be grown outdoors in warm, humid climates.

Snake Plant

The Snake plant is popularly known as mother-in-law’s tongue and viper’s bowstring hemp as it is one of the sources of plant fibers used to make bowstrings. It is an evergreen perennial plant, native to tropical West Africa from Nigeria East to the Congo. Recommended by NASA as one of the best plants for improving indoor air quality, the strikingly beautiful Snake plant is low-maintenance that makes it an excellent choice for homes and offices.

Succulents

Succulents are a group of plants with thick and fleshy leaves. They store water in their stems and leaves and thrive well in dry climates that make them perfect to grow in the UAE. They are able to thrive on limited water resources and can tolerate prolonged drought, sometimes for months.

Tropical Hibiscus

The tropical hibiscus is an evergreen perennial that features large trumpet-shaped flowers. It thrives in warm and hot temperatures that won’t survive under 10 degree Celsius. It is a summer-blooming plant that grows well in pots or in the landscapes. This plant is absolutely perfect to add colors and accentuate the look of decks, balconies, terraces, and gardens.

Bougainvillea

A common garden plant native to South America from Brazil west to Peru and south to southern Argentina. It blooms white flowers surrounded by bright tracts of pink, purple, red, magenta, orange or yellow. This vine-like plant can grow up to 12 meters, which can cover garden walls and fences while adding a splash of color.

Growing these plants will enhance the beauty of your home and garden and help regulate the temperature in the hot environment of the UAE.
